Lakers sail past Devils

FREDONIA, N.Y. -- The Fredonia State men's basketball team fell to Oswego, 85-68, Saturday in a SUNYAC matchup. Tyler Roberts led the Devils with 14 points, including 4-of-5 from three-point land. Marcus Patterson had 11 points, Dydy Bryan contributed 10 points and nine assists. Moussa Samassa chipped in with nine points and nine rebounds. 
 
Fredonia State kept things close early on, leading 12-8 with 14 minutes left to play. Oswego scored the next nine points, and would go on to lead 47-33 by the break.

Oswego's Jermiah Sparks, Julian Crittendon and Joe Sullivan combined for 37 of the Lakers 47 first-half points. The Lakers shot 60 percent from the floor and 4 of 8 from behind the arc in the half. 
 
Tyler Roberts led Fredonia scoring with 8 first half points. The Devils shot a solid 48 percent from the field. 
 
Oswego scored the first five points of the second half to give them their biggest lead of the game at 19 points, 52-33.

Fredonia would whittle the lead down to nine points. Following a layup by Adam Braniecki and a three pointer by Marcus Patterson at the 12:35 mark that completed a 15-5 run, Oswego's lead was cut to 57-48.

Oswego came right back with a 10-2 run to thwart the Devils' rally and take control of the game. 

Sparks led the Lakers scoring with 23 points, Crittendon had 16, Sullivan had 14, and Louis Fedullo had 10.
 
Oswego moves to 14-4 on the year and 8-3 in the SUNYAC. 
 
Fredonia State drops to 7-11 and 3-8 in the SUNYAC. They play host to Brockport on Tuesday. Tipoff is slated for 7:30 p.m.
